From Summer Visitor to Local Realtor: Suzanne Runyon's Maine Journey

Suzanne Runyon Camden Photo

In 1977, a young girl named Suzanne fell in love with Camden during family vacations to the coast. Decades later, she now lives and works in the very town that first captured her imagination. Today, as a Camden realtor, she helps others begin their own Maine story, right where hers began.
